When grapefruit blocks this enzyme the medication can pass from the gut to the bloodstream... north central medical plazaWebMay 9, 2024 · Official answer. Drinking alcohol while taking metronidazole is not recommended because the combination of metronidazole and alcohol can cause a reaction (often referred to as a disulfiram-like reaction) in some people.
